> Grant, Vinod,
>
> Don't you think it would make sense to generalize nr-channels and maybe
> also the capabilities properties for other dmaengine drivers?
> I have seen other dmaengine drivers taking the number of channels from
> platform data so that would make sense.
> It would be new dmaengine device tree properties, but on the other hand,
> I do not know if code can also be centralized for handling of those
> properties... maybe it is better to let drivers deal with them if
> required...
>
We already having this discussion and how to change capabilities etc to
make thing more easy and transparent, See the approaches taken by Jassi
and Linus W
